Konfigurieren Sie Docker für das Setup des Headless-Browsers in Microsoft Windows

  • Freigeben Version: Zurich
  • Aktualisiert 31. Juli 2025
  • 1 Minute Lesedauer
  • Konfigurieren Sie den Docker-Server, um alle Anforderungen zu authentifizieren.

    Vorbereitungen

    Schritt 2 Abschließen: Generieren Sie Zertifikate für das Setup des Headless-Browsers für Microsoft Windows

    Erforderliche Rolle: administrator auf Ihrem ServiceNowInstanz und lokaler Administrator auf dem Hostcomputer.

    Warum und wann dieser Vorgang ausgeführt wird

    Nachdem Sie Ihre Client- und Serverschlüssel erstellt haben, konfigurieren Sie jetzt den Docker-Server so, dass alle Anforderungen mit diesen Schlüsseln authentifiziert werden, und stellen die Docker-API auf Port 2376 bereit.

    Prozedur

    1. Konfigurieren Sie Docker so, dass die Zertifikate verwendet werden, die Sie in Schritt 2 generiert haben.
    2. Suchen oder erstellen Sie C:\ProgramData\Docker\config\Daemon.JSON Datei.
    3. Fügen Sie der Datei „Daemon.JSON“ die folgenden Eigenschaften hinzu.
      Ersetzen Sie Elemente in diesen Befehlen durch die richtigen Pfade zu Ihren Zertifikaten:
      Hinweis:
      Die doppelten Schrägstriche müssen genau kopiert werden.
      {
      "tlscacert": "C:\\Users\\Administrator\\certs\\ca.pem",
      "tlscert": "C:\\Users\\Administrator\\certs\\server-cert.pem",
      "tlscert": "C:\\Users\\Administrator\\certs\\server-cert.pem",
      "tlskey": "C:\\Users\\Administrator\\certs\\server-key.pem",
      "tlsverify": true,
      "hosts": ["tcp://0.0.0.0:2376", "npipe://"]
      }
      Weitere Informationen finden Sie unter Konfigurieren Sie den Docker-Daemon .
    4. Führen Sie in Administrator PowerShell aus Neustart-Service *Docker*